Re: My boats actual name?
You know, you really can't go by the number......for example, check out the promotional material section of our club site. The 1998 catalog lists a "183" Shabah and a "182" Shabah. Both measure 18.0 ft, but the 183 is a closed foredeck and the 182 is a bow rider. It's not like a 182 is 18'2" and the 183 is 18'3". I recall a post from a club member who was actually a Mariah employee. He said that the numbers and model names were always changing, and didn't have a set pattern.

Re: My boats actual name?
Different manufacturers measure different ways, from what I've read. Maybe someone on here will know how Mariah did it. It's somewhere in the vicinity of from bow to stern though. For fishing tournaments they measure at the water line.
It does not count swim platforms or stern drives. My 19'er is just over 23' overall, with her leg up. |
